    It's been a while since I updated pictures of my garage Mostly because I am retired and have learned to take my time doing things

    It's been so long since I posted pictures that the old thread is sooo old that I've deleted the photo's I posted there, except for the 3 attachments..

    I am almost done. I am trying to figure out a way to display my "Hogan Golf Clubs." They were my very first set and the are S/N matching. I left space on the opposite wall from where Abby is parked to mount them.

    There are 3 cabinets on the wall opposite Abby near the garage door opening. Then there are one each at the front of the garage on each side. Across the front of the garage and the side Abby naps I hung some old photo’s and memorabilia, which includes posters with signatures from Nolan Adams and Zora Duntov

    I thought about hanging some of my "OLD Plaques but Nanc used to refer to my garage in Modesto as a Corvette Shrine. Besides most are old and from a time long, long ago. I have long since dismantled all my trophies and used the parts for Flagg Poles, help the club out with making trophies for events (Modesto Club) and tossed a bunch of the left over parts.

    Recapping a little:
    • Patched all the walls, filled all the nail/screw holes. Painted two tone Metallic Charcoal Gray bottom with Cream White divided by Red White & Blue stripe.
    • Recessed florescent light fixture.
    • Recessed spot lights over the rear area of parked car. Light for trunk area with garage door closed (useless with the door open )
    • New steel access attic drop down ladder.
    • New exhaust fan to allow heat and fumes to vent through the ceiling also acts as a whole house fan.
    • Crown molding
    • Removed the “Popcorn Ceiling Stuff
    • Had the floor professionally epoxy’d
    • Tiled the front end of the garage.
    • Did a little re-wiring
    • Installed cabinets (5 Total)

    These are not the best pictures of RARE, the lighting is two florescent fixtures. One 8' with 2 bulbs and the one above RARE is a 4' fixture with 2 bulbs... with the rear doors closed there ain't much natural light, and I was too lazy to open the doors

    Here is RARE napping in the shop




    The shop is insulated and has heat, but no airconditioning where RARE is parked it is 12' wide. The previous owner used it for his boat storage. The front of the shop is a bit bigger and the over all length is 29' so there is room in front of RARE for my work bench, tool caddy, storage. When I do my wood working I back RARE out onto the driveway
